Normal weight gain especially for LMB females should be 1 lb body mass (not including eggs) per year in northern waters. More weight gain per year than 1 lb/yr with abundant proper sized forage can easily happen esp in southern waters due to longer growing season. Less than 1 lb per yr indicates inadequate forage.
